Lithologic Log
(Log data entered by KGS.) | ||
From: 0 ft. to 2 ft. | top soil | |
From: 2 ft. to 32 ft. | brown clay | |
From: 32 ft. to 47 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 47 ft. to 53 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el | |
From: 53 ft. to 58 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 58 ft. to 70 ft. | brown clay | |
From: 70 ft. to 91 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 91 ft. to 235 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el | |
From: 235 ft. to 244 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 244 ft. to 293 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el | |
From: 293 ft. to 311 ft. | brown clay | |
From: 311 ft. to 313 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el | |
From: 313 ft. to 317 ft. | brown clay | |
From: 317 ft. to 320 ft. | cemented gravel - hard pull down 300 | |
From: 320 ft. to 329 ft. | brown clay - small gravel streak | |
From: 329 ft. to 335 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el | |
From: 335 ft. to 354 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el - clay streak | |
From: 354 ft. to 368 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el - tight | |
From: 368 ft. to 377 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 377 ft. to 389 ft. | fine to medium sand and gravel | |
From: 389 ft. to 395 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 395 ft. to 401 ft. | cemented sandstone - hard white rock strip - pull down 200 | |
From: 401 ft. to 412 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
From: 412 ft. to 494 ft. | brown clay | |
From: 494 ft. to 515 ft. | yellow clay |
